I'm in urgent need of advice. My Firefox keeps crashing when I open it and sometimes Windows explorer crashes too, after FF crashes. I'm now forced to use IE :sick:
Please help me out. I hate IE. I've re-installed FF but to no avail.
 
If it starts with no add-ons enabled then you know where the problem lies :) Then you can start enabling them one at a time until you find the one responsible for the instability.
 
Ok it opens fine with no add-ons, but the thing is, I've deleted my profile, which means I have no add-ons, but still get those errors. Plus I re-installed it but still getting those errors. Perhaps I should try uninstalling first and then see. Thanks so much buddy :)
